How do rendering tools simulate inboxes?

Rendering tools maintain environments replicating email client configurations. They send your test email to these environments, capture screenshots of how messages display, and present results for comparison.

Environment types: actual email clients installed on various systems (real rendering), virtual machines simulating client configurations, and browser-based webmail captures. Combination ensures authentic representation.

Maintenance challenge: email clients update frequently. Quality tools update their environments to match current client versions. Outdated rendering environments show how emails looked months ago, not how they appear to recipients today.
